Charitable objects

THE PROMOTION OF COMMUNITY PARTICIPATION IN HEALTHY RECREATION IN PARTICULAR BY THE PROVISION OF FACILITIES FOR THE COMPETITIVE AND SOCIAL PLAYING OF CROQUET.

Governing document: CIO - ASSOCIATION Registered 20 Dec 2018
